Villa Duchesne, a Catholic independent school rooted in the Sacred Heart tradition, is seeking a passionate and dedicated full-time Lower School Elementary Teacher to join our vibrant learning community. This position requires an experienced educator who is committed to fostering academic excellence, spiritual growth, and character development in young learners. The ideal candidate demonstrates a deep love for teaching and for working with children, brings a strong work ethic to their professional practice, and values collaboration with colleagues, students, and families.
We seek an educator who is enthusiastic about creating an engaging classroom environment, supporting the growth of the whole child, and contributing positively to a community that values curiosity, compassion, and lifelong learning.
Qualifications & Requirements:
The ideal candidate will:
Hold a bachelor’s degree in elementary education (master’s degree preferred).Have prior experience teaching at the elementary level, with a deep understanding of child development and best practices in education.
Demonstrate a deep commitment to student-centered learning and differentiated instruction to meet the needs of diverse learners.
Have an expert understanding of teaching pedagogy in literacy, writing, and mathematics.
Implement a rigorous, engaging, and developmentally appropriate curriculum aligned with the school’s mission and academic standards.
Utilize innovative teaching strategies and technology to enhance learning experiences.
Collaborate with colleagues, parents, and school leadership to support the academic, emotional, and spiritual growth of each student.
Communicates thoughtfully and respectfully, demonstrating strong organizational skills and a commitment to clear, compassionate dialogue with colleagues, students, and families.
Partners with parents in support of each child’s growth, communicating openly and respectfully about student progress, curriculum, and child development.
Embraces collaborative teaching, working closely with teammates to design engaging and appropriately challenging learning experiences while seeking meaningful interdisciplinary connections that enrich student learning.
Values ongoing professional growth through reflection, collaboration, and continuous learning.
